He Kōrero mō te tūranga - About the Role
We have an exciting opportunity for a Social Worker/Case Manager with Mental Health experience to join our Mental Health Services for Older People (MHSOP) Community Team. The role will be part of our mahi of supporting Tangata Whaiora and their whānau in their journey to wellness.
You will work with the Tauranga community MHSOP services, as well as the Tauranga based inpatient MHSOP ward, health partners, referred clients, their families/whānau and the community to provide psychoeducational groups, one to one assessment and support, and provision of assessments to assist clients to maintain independence and safety.
The focus is to deliver high quality care to the growing population in the Bay of Plenty. At the heart of our services are our CARE values - Compassion, All-one-team, Responsive and Excellence. We have a commitment to working in partnership and collaboration with consumers, family/whanau and the community.
This is a 0.8FTE (32 hours per week) on a 12-month fixed-term position to cover parental leave.

Mō Tātou - About Us
Situated in the sunny eastern coast of New Zealand's North Island, the Bay of Plenty really is just that, offering vast golden sand beaches, bush clad mountains, lush farmlands and more. Its pleasant climate means that the area has become a favourite for holiday makers, retirees and those looking for a different lifestyle outside of the main cities.
Te Whatu Ora - Health New Zealand, Hauora a Toi Bay of Plenty is spread across a vast geographical area and centred across two hospitals based in Tauranga and Whakatāne. We serve a population of approximately 308,000 for the major population centres of Tauranga, Katikati, Te Puke, Whakatāne, Kawerau and Ōpōtiki. Te Whatu Ora Hauora a Toi Bay of Plenty is one of the Bay of Plenty's largest employers with over 4000 staff.
